Output d97f0c18f8babcd7239bd488bc4e7265bfc353a6cc09cca4ffe5ef1d16f1df6e:5

value
517164
script pubkey
OP_0 OP_PUSHBYTES_20 c2fa9854cc8421314da0c2a05341014606607684
address
bc1qctafs4xvsssnzndqc2s9xsgpgcrxqa5yxuf4vu
transaction
d97f0c18f8babcd7239bd488bc4e7265bfc353a6cc09cca4ffe5ef1d16f1df6e
confirmations
128931
spent
true